GETTING TO KNOW JEFF

Jeff is currently the director of strength and conditioning for the United Football League (UFL). Jeff is responsible for designing and implementing strength training programs league wide.

 

Jeff earned his bachelor’s degree in Curriculum and Instruction and received his Master’s Degree in Exercise Science. Jeff is a Certified Strength and Conditioning Specialist by the National Strength and Conditioning Association, a Certified Level 1 Strength Coach by the United States Weightlifting Federation, a Nationally Certified Practitioner by the National Certification Board for Therapeutic Massage & Bodywork, a Certified Active Release (ART) Provider, and a Functional Movement Screen (FMS) Certified Specialist.
 
In 2000, Friday was named Professional Strength and Conditioning Coach of the Year by a vote of his peers in the Professional Football Strength and Conditioning Coaches Society. Additionally, Jeff has written on numerous topics for BaltimoreRavens.com, Coaching Women’s Basketball, High Intensity Training Newsletter, Strength and Conditioning Association Journal, and has been a contributing author for Stack Magazine.
